在xml解析中帮助我

时间:2010-12-13 12:01:02

标签: iphone

我得到了包含100个子标签的xml文件.....

我只需解析10个标签...当我点击按钮时,我需要解析另外10个标签......

根据我的要求,我会解析数据...

我想术语是分页......

任何人都可以帮助我......

@thanks提前。

4 个答案:

答案 0 :(得分:1)

如果您需要分页并且内存不是问题,我建议一次解析整个xml,然后将所有标记存储在数组中。如果您确定10个标签的要求不会改变,您可以为每个标签分配一个大小为10的数组,其中最多包含10个标签。或者包含100个元素的数组,每个元素对应一个元素。无论你发现什么都比较容易。

答案 1 :(得分:0)

为什么要一点一点地解析xml文件?你不能只解析整个文件,将标签存储在一个数组中,一次引用10个吗?

答案 2 :(得分:0)

更改您正在使用的Web服务以包含起始索引和结束索引,这将为您提供调用Web服务所需的范围,因此您只需解析为响应您的请求而返回的数据。 / p>

答案 3 :(得分:0)

正常解析从上到下,您的代码处理您关心的10个标签。你可以忽略其他的90。